Dental Implants Restore More Than Your Smile

Dental ImplantsIt’s important to replace missing teeth. Your smile doesn’t function – or look – the same without a complete set of healthy teeth. Speech, chewing, appearance, and oral health can suffer when teeth are missing. And studies show that if a missing tooth isn’t replaced, the likelihood of additional tooth loss dramatically increases.

The Structure of an Implant
A dental implant is a three-part system: a small titanium screw, an abutment, and an implant crown. A surgeon places the screw in the jawbone, which starts a process called osseointegration. This just means that the bone tissue and the implant screw bond to create a firm foundation. The abutment fits atop the screw to hold one or more replacement teeth in place.

Dental Implant Options
Depending on your unique needs and expectations, Dr. Thompson may recommend a single implant to replace an individual missing tooth, an implant-supported bridge to replace a few missing teeth in a row, or a denture secured with dental implants. Implant-supported dentures can be removable, or fixed in place to eliminate the need to take your replacement teeth out to clean them. Benefits of Dental Implants
Dental implants stop the jawbone atrophy that occurs when you lose teeth. They restore the foundation for facial skin and muscles to eliminate that sunken-in look, and they help renew clear speech. With implants, you can eat what you want, fully taste your food, and smile confidently. Your dental implants have the potential to deliver a lifetime of smiles if cared for properly.
